diff --git a/.travis.settings.xml b/.travis.settings.xml deleted file mode 100644 index 5c65a2e..0000000 --- a/.travis.settings.xml +++ /dev/null @@ -1,14 +0,0 @@ - - - - nexus-snapshots - ${env.MAVEN_REPO_USERNAME} - ${env.MAVEN_REPO_PASSWORD} - - - nexus-releases - ${env.MAVEN_REPO_USERNAME} - ${env.MAVEN_REPO_PASSWORD} - - - \ No newline at end of file diff --git a/.travis.yml b/.travis.yml deleted file mode 100644 index 7b1020e..0000000 --- a/.travis.yml +++ /dev/null @@ -1,76 +0,0 @@ -# Build script for Travis CI -# - -# use xenial distribution -dist: xenial - -# no need to check for oracle's java -language: java -jdk: openjdk8 - -# speed up builds by caching maven local repository -cache: - directories: - - "$HOME/.m2/repository" - -# as agreed in our SOP -branches: - only: - - master - - development - - /^release\/.*$/ - - /^hotfix\/.*$/ - - /^[vV]?\d+\.\d+\.\d+$/ # matches e.g., v1.2.3, 1.2.3, V1.2.3 - -# added to make logs look cleaner, crisper, certified fresh -before_install: unset _JAVA_OPTIONS - -# speed up builds by telling Travis that we don't need any special "installation" -install: true - -# as agreed in our SOP, build everything (don't deploy, just try to 'mvn install' locally, which covers all phases) -script: mvn --quiet --activate-profiles !development-build,!release-build --settings .travis.settings.xml clean cobertura:cobertura install -# upload code coverage report, generate maven site (javadocs, documentation, static code analysis, etc.) -after_success: -- bash <(curl -s https://codecov.io/bash) -- mvn --quiet --activate-profiles !development-build,!release-build --settings .travis.settings.xml site - -# upload to maven -deploy: - # as agreed in our SOP, builds on development branch will deploy to our maven repository after validating - # the artifact has a proper SNAPSHOT version - # artifact will be installed in our testing instance if it is a .war file -- skip_cleanup: true - provider: script - script: echo "development deployment" && mvn --quiet --activate-profiles development-build,!release-build --settings .travis.settings.xml deploy - on: - branch: development - condition: '"$TRAVIS_EVENT_TYPE" = "push"' - # as agreed in our SOP, tagging a commit on the master branch will upload to our maven repository - # after validating the artifact has a proper release version - # artifact will be installed in our testing instance if it is a .war file -- skip_cleanup: true - provider: script - script: echo "master deployment" && mvn --quiet --activate-profiles !development-build,release-build --settings .travis.settings.xml deploy - on: - branch: master - condition: '"$TRAVIS_EVENT_TYPE" = "push"' - -# change according to your needs, but we recommend to deactivate email notifications -# for now, we configured Travis to send a notification to the #travis-ci channel -notifications: - email: - on_success: never - on_failure: never - slack: - on_success: never - on_failure: always - # edit the following section if you want to get slack notifications - rooms: - - secure: "***" - -# encrypted variables -env: - global: - - secure: "LlC638W4guO/Jv8mFTl2ifQG9iFLqkCCjqKrDZkKzWd2KdZBDFygB1dSXVWgORYhzOonfpURiXAiddmKor2w6yO/t9o9MxJ3iN9l6qZCQurNyCb91WhGHKAPy502Ig407rJk8aLPIHgwNVu8PtFJmQFOH5W24YyoVDCjvG5u8hOmNaqdsc7WSkTBThGQsElR16Vm+LA9EbFVBSdhu/QN0slLiqoA2D7MgUFc3Jsxv1PYXrOWUQ5uHZ6VRAdmcYVp1Qt07nuu1QcMr0TEOvCgmyUD8B1FTAuXPYJxLbqvQ8VdgXS99bbbsAC0cxJl/aLjFYeOiJNv79MdG7DM1cbnJwx2pQMvCiFiuukz2NOsffDeR+9M5QbMo3QbjBvzJeQqPm1Ecqk8B7VN0dWpyHlkLzR0qNVOMs6dzfAVpXvLNF7fXf0pZKPE/EzuSxIDLrJtJlKXdyxs0gd8vz2YTtTalwlA6Fr5OZel6pIj3BvphYt4/14PxtNQXL3NDF4r4h0IvjzMYv2SUa2v/hyxORB7P1zgujq8Cf6xG1jz31D5uC3c/g4mOxfY6+b/6Dkbwk5liylOMNNKSknr6IkcfO5NL90BzcE08V7hExci8D1MyMvSNmHnDCxKYySnUeaadOzEXUyZoL5BvMOGi4t2wM1SXvF9K6IKnWu68ooPYNUjeFs=" - - secure: "AeLiIp7pkGAiokeyTPdVBpVUj1Cp+o/1vWQbvOr4vvOGUJl5hqahRU/A4sWWVb+oPrVbAVt5U/PxPpevTz/27f/rIfYx3jB2YNjgrJ8VE2JfPlBw2bnvnF8YOcimDPmgqHvnNdF319JzdGvv4acucEfbIhj/yfgGsjCi0/7zlDyhJojobyhjF196VsZfxQQNTJCURPbgTU9XciE4JX1dxkpv3Hht/XiJ/WWNUcMsgwWiuVlyeScc64i8giWvpOYmcj11Q0PQFNRwRJ/K4sbRV7GaNhBXTbkmOENGlGapA1MfOQ1726VT/SCzC88DUQLjfVXoOs215VjdSU13B1J6fVN0WJrJcyt6ZjigoaRhrMtFGsuEpegdZGTZn2uo6bJxGY4XPfzy1eshaAx892IfWMC358F+/a89a22v6LmlVQIWtJkos0bQRbvPYMt+eQalwdXAnt4ljL5llxuf7240jAjj0hM2WVRxkgxwIJpfrK7Q4vBGkFQ2Crlrjk3g+TqH4i2zelON5FzhrTSS2N+wu6Zp1+7dhgOm5KSyZTguKmsXKN+gu7BIrVvza0ZDuEQjrgCAZ0kBDtoEAxTdLh3NAf3l2XqkvAlHnsfYA7nJSDkB+Y6mIduRVRsyrr2QazDW6F6jPZzALdNP6BaZbEzbGMCEFnpBeqlJNJtlxNf94sU=" diff --git a/CHANGELOG.md b/CHANGELOG.md index d9f4274..0a82ceb 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-1,5 +1,9 @@ # Changelog +## 1.9.4 (2022-01-04) +* Fix CVE-2021-44832 +* Increase log4j-version `2.17.0` -> `2.17.1` + ## 1.9.3 (2021-12-20) * Fix CVE-2021-45105 * Increase log4j-version `2.16.0` -> `2.17.0` diff --git a/pom.xml b/pom.xml index a99612f..93ec758 100644 --- a/pom.xml +++ b/pom.xml @@ -9,14 +9,14 @@ 3.1.4 user-db-portlet - 1.9.3 + 1.9.4 User Database Portlet http://github.com/qbicsoftware/user-db-portlet war 7.7.28 7.7.28 - 2.17.0 + 2.17.1